Understanding Technical Specifications and Configuration Variations

When sourcing a hydraulic detachable lowboy trailer, buyers must first navigate a complex landscape of technical specifications that vary significantly between manufacturers. The core functionality of these trailers relies on a hydraulic system that allows the front ramp to detach and lower, facilitating the loading of heavy equipment that cannot be driven onto a standard flatbed. Based on observed market data, the structural integrity of these units is often defined by the material grade and beam construction. Common configurations utilize steel with a "Heavy Duty" or "Medium Duty" classification, depending on the intended load profile. The main beam height is a critical dimension, with specific observations noting a height of 500 mm, where the upper plate construction is a key determinant of strength.

The physical dimensions of the trailer are equally vital for logistics planning. Observed data indicates a standard length of 13,000 mm, with widths typically around 3,000 mm and heights varying between 1,650 mm and 1,700 mm when unloaded. The tread width, a measure of the usable deck space, is observed at 1,820 mm in certain configurations. The wheelbase, which influences maneuverability and stability, generally falls within the 7,000 to 8,000 mm range. Buyers should verify these dimensions against their specific cargo requirements, as the "detachable" nature of the trailer allows for a lower deck height, but the overall footprint remains substantial.

Suspension systems are another area of significant variation. The market presents both "Multi-link Type" and "Cross Arm Type" suspension options. The choice between these systems impacts how the trailer handles uneven terrain and distributes weight across the axles. The axle configuration is typically standardized around three axles, with a common specification of 3 x 13-ton axles, often sourced from reputable brands like Fuwa. The landing gear, essential for stabilizing the trailer when detached from the towing vehicle, is frequently rated at 28 tons, with some models offering double-speed operation for efficiency. Tire specifications also vary, with 1100r20 radial tires in quantities of 12 pieces being a standard observation for heavy-duty models.

Compliance, Certification, and Regulatory Standards

Navigating the regulatory landscape is a non-negotiable aspect of sourcing heavy transport equipment. The compliance status of a lowboy trailer determines its eligibility for operation in specific jurisdictions and its ability to clear customs. The observed certification landscape includes a diverse array of standards such as ISO, DOT, ECE, GCC, and CCC. Specific product listings have referenced combinations like "CCC, ISO, BV, WMI" or "CE, ISO, BV, CCC." It is crucial for buyers to understand that these certifications are not uniform across all units; a specific model may carry one set of certifications while another carries a different set.

The "CCC" (China Compulsory Certification) is frequently observed in the context of domestic Chinese manufacturing, while "DOT" and "ECE" are critical for markets in North America and Europe, respectively. The "GCC" certification is relevant for Gulf Cooperation Council countries. Buyers must verify that the specific unit they intend to purchase holds the certifications required for their target market. Relying on a general statement of compliance is insufficient; the certification status must be validated against the specific product model number, such as ELPDGST03, ALP9350LBST, or SCD9400TDP.

Furthermore, the production standards often align with customer needs rather than a single universal standard. Some listings indicate that the product standard is "By The Customer Needs," suggesting a high degree of customization. However, other entries reference adherence to specific standards like "CCC ISO BV WMI" or "CE ISO BV CCC." The presence of third-party inspection bodies like BV (Bureau Veritas) in the certification strings adds a layer of verification, but the buyer must confirm that the inspection report covers the specific batch or unit being procured. The absence of ABS (Anti-lock Braking System) in some observed models, such as those with a "Dual Line Braking System" noted as "None ABS," highlights the importance of verifying safety features against local road safety regulations.

Typical Applications and Operational Use Cases

Hydraulic detachable lowboy trailers are engineered for specialized transport scenarios where standard trailers cannot accommodate the cargo. The primary application is the transportation of oversized and overweight machinery, such as construction equipment, mining machinery, and industrial generators. The detachable ramp feature allows these heavy assets to be driven or winched onto the deck at a very low angle, minimizing the risk of ground clearance issues that would plague a conventional flatbed.

The load capacity range of 50 to 80 tons makes these trailers suitable for moving large-scale industrial components. For instance, a 50-ton capacity unit is ideal for mid-sized construction machinery, while an 80-ton unit is necessary for heavy mining excavators or large transformers. The "Flatbed" shape observed in the product attributes suggests a versatile deck that can be secured with chains or binders for various types of cargo. The "Self-dumping" attribute is explicitly noted as "Not Self-dumping," indicating that these units rely on external lifting equipment or winches for loading and unloading, which is typical for this class of trailer.

The operational environment also dictates the choice of suspension system. The "Cross Arm Type" and "Multi-link Type" suspensions observed in the market data are designed to handle the dynamic loads and road irregularities associated with transporting heavy machinery over long distances.
